RPA(机器人流程自动化)是一种通过软件机器人模拟人类操作的技术,广泛应用于企业信息化和数字化领域。本文将从RPA的基本概念、应用场景、设计原则、实施中的常见问题、解决方案以及未来趋势等方面,深入探讨RPA的应用与设计,帮助企业更好地理解和应用这一技术。
1. RPA基本概念与定义
1.1 什么是RPA?
RPA(Robotic Process Automation,机器人流程自动化)是一种通过软件机器人模拟人类操作的技术,能够自动执行重复性、规则性强的任务。简单来说,RPA就是让“机器人”代替人类完成那些枯燥、繁琐的工作。
1.2 RPA的核心特点
- 自动化:RPA能够自动执行任务,减少人工干预。
- 规则性:RPA适用于规则明确、流程固定的任务。
- 高效性:RPA可以24/7不间断工作,大幅提升效率。
- 可扩展性:RPA可以根据需求灵活扩展,适应不同规模的业务。
2. RPA应用实例与场景
2.1 财务与会计
在财务领域,RPA可以自动处理发票、对账、报表生成等任务。例如,某企业通过RPA实现了每月数千张发票的自动处理,节省了大量人力成本。
2.2 客户服务
RPA可以自动处理客户查询、订单跟踪、投诉处理等任务。例如,某电商平台通过RPA实现了客户订单状态的自动更新,提升了客户满意度。
2.3 人力资源
在人力资源领域,RPA可以自动处理员工入职、离职、考勤管理等任务。例如,某公司通过RPA实现了员工考勤数据的自动统计,减少了HR的工作量。
3. RPA设计原则与流程
3.1 设计原则
- 明确目标:在设计RPA流程时,首先要明确自动化目标,确保流程清晰、可执行。
- 简化流程:尽量简化流程,避免复杂的逻辑和判断,提高RPA的执行效率。
- 可维护性:设计时要考虑流程的可维护性,确保未来能够方便地进行修改和优化。
3.2 设计流程
- 需求分析:明确自动化需求,确定哪些任务适合RPA。
- 流程设计:根据需求设计自动化流程,绘制流程图。
- 开发与测试:开发RPA脚本,并进行测试,确保流程正确无误。
- 部署与监控:将RPA流程部署到生产环境,并持续监控其运行状态。
4. RPA实施中的常见问题
4.1 流程复杂性
有些业务流程过于复杂,难以通过RPA实现自动化。例如,涉及大量人工判断和决策的流程,RPA可能无法胜任。
4.2 数据质量问题
RPA的执行依赖于高质量的数据。如果数据不准确或不完整,RPA的执行效果将大打折扣。
4.3 技术兼容性
RPA需要与现有系统进行集成,如果系统之间存在兼容性问题,RPA的实施将面临挑战。
5. 解决RPA部署挑战的策略
5.1 流程优化
在实施RPA之前,先对现有流程进行优化,简化流程,减少复杂性,确保RPA能够顺利执行。
5.2 数据治理
加强数据治理,确保数据的准确性和完整性。可以通过数据清洗、数据验证等手段,提升数据质量。
5.3 技术集成
在实施RPA时,充分考虑技术兼容性,选择适合的RPA工具,并与现有系统进行充分集成,确保RPA能够顺利运行。
6. RPA未来趋势与发展方向
6.1 智能化
未来的RPA将更加智能化,结合AI技术,能够处理更复杂的任务,如自然语言处理、图像识别等。
6.2 云化
随着云计算的发展,RPA将逐渐向云端迁移,实现更灵活的部署和管理。
6.3 行业化
RPA将更加行业化,针对不同行业的特点,开发出更加专业化的解决方案,满足不同行业的需求。
RPA作为一种高效、灵活的自动化技术,正在逐步改变企业的运营方式。通过理解RPA的基本概念、应用场景、设计原则以及实施中的常见问题,企业可以更好地利用RPA提升效率、降低成本。未来,随着技术的不断进步,RPA将在更多领域发挥重要作用,推动企业信息化和数字化的进一步发展。
原创文章,作者:IamIT,如若转载,请注明出处:https://docs.ihr360.com/strategy/it_strategy/270075